The History Channel has been hosting a new series called Patton 360. It covers the career of George Patten from his initial invasion of North Africa, through his series of campaigns till his death. No new ground covered by the subject, but what I do like as a miniature gamer is the plethora of images of various weapons used by the Americans, the Brits, the Germans and the Italians during the WWII campaigns that Patten participated in.

For those looking for inspiration for painting their 25mm or 15mm FOW miniatures, seek out this series and add it to your collection.

For those looking for scenario inspirations there are wonderful maps and tactical movements, along with orders of battle for most of the engagements that Patten was involved in, give this series a view!
